温馨提示×

hive datediff能处理闰年日期吗

小樊
81
2024-12-20 20:09:04
栏目: 大数据

Hive的DATEDIFF函数确实可以处理闰年日期。DATEDIFF函数在Hive中用于计算两个日期之间的天数差异,它会自动考虑闰年的情况。

以下是一个简单的示例,展示了如何使用DATEDIFF函数来计算两个日期之间的天数差异,包括跨越闰年的情况:

SELECT DATEDIFF(date '2020-02-28', date '2020-03-01') AS days_diff;

在这个示例中,DATEDIFF函数计算了从2020年2月28日到2020年3月1日之间的天数差异。尽管2020年是闰年,但DATEDIFF函数仍然正确地返回了1天。

因此,您可以放心地使用Hive的DATEDIFF函数来处理包含闰年的日期计算。

0